The AirTAC AirTAC GC60020AC2GK F.R.L. Combination Unit, G3/4 Port is a genuine G-series three-unit F.R.L. combination: a separate filter, a separate regulator and a separate lubricator assembled as one air-preparation station. It has PT3/4" ports, a 40 µm element, a automatic drain and regulates 0.15 - 0.9 MPa (20 - 130 psi).
The AirTAC GC60020AC2GK is a three-piece F.R.L. combination: a separate air filter, pressure regulator and oil-mist lubricator assembled as one supply-preparation set. This size 600 unit carries a G3/4 (3/4 in) port with G thread, the largest step in the GC range. The filter section uses the standard 40 um element with an automatic drain, so collected condensate is expelled without manual attention, and the aluminium alloy bowl suits higher-demand installations. The standard regulator covers an adjustment range of 0.15-0.9 MPa (20-130 psi), read on the fitted round psi gauge, and a reverse/check valve is fitted to hold downstream settings. A mounting bracket is included.
This is a genuine AirTAC part. The GC family spans sizes 200, 300, 400 and 600 with port options from 1/8 in to 1 in, and choices of drain type, 40 um or 5 um (W) filtration, gauge scale and thread (PT standard, with G and NPT as order options). The regulating band is set by the drain type: automatic and differential-pressure drains regulate 0.15 - 0.9 MPa, a manual drain regulates 0.05 - 0.9 MPa. Standard type, regulating 0.15 - 0.9 MPa (20 - 130 psi). The combination has no separate bracket code — the three units couple together with their own mounting hardware. | GC600 | G-series F.R.L. combination, 600 body — sets the port range. |
|---|---|
| 20 | Port size PT3/4". This body offers 20 = PT3/4", 25 = PT1". |
| A | Drain: Automatic drain — this also sets the regulating band (0.15 - 0.9 MPa (20 - 130 psi)). |
| (blank) | Standard type. Blank is standard, L is the low-pressure type. |
| (blank) | Pressure gauge fitted (blank). |
| C | Gauge shape: Round. C is round, F is square. |
| 2 | Gauge scale: psi. 1 is MPa, 2 is psi, 3 is bar. |
| (blank) | Filtering grade 40 µm. Only 40 µm (blank) and 5 µm (W) exist. |
| G | G (BSPP) thread. PT is the default; G is BSPP and T is NPT. |
| K | Reverse-flow (reflux) valve fitted. |
Field order is size, port, drain, type, gauge, shape, scale, grade, thread, reflux — there is no bracket position on a combination. Constituent units, orderable separately as spares: GF600-20 filter, GR600-20 regulator and GL600-20 lubricator.
A GC is three separate units, so the filter and the regulator can each be serviced or replaced on their own. A GFC is the two-unit set, where filtering and regulating share one body — shorter, but the two functions come as one part. Both filter, regulate and lubricate.

The aluminium-alloy bowls on the GC600 suit harsher environments than PC bowls. The lubricator adds an oil mist downstream of the regulator. If any branch of the line must stay oil-free, take that branch off before the lubricator, or use a GR600-20 regulator with a GF600-20 filter on that branch.

Code A in GC60020AC2GK specifies an automatic drain, which expels collected condensate from the filter bowl without manual attention - useful on lines that run unattended. Manual and differential-pressure drains are the other catalogue choices if you would rather control drainage yourself.
